Escondido Real Estate: On-The-Go Tips For the Family This Summer

Vacation is one thing that families shouldn't skip doing every summer. It is the time where families enjoy each others' companies and be in the perfect place to have fun. However, the joys and fun of vacation also come along with some certain level of stress.

So here are some tips that you may consider to keep the stress level during vacation at a minimum or even none at all:

  • Pick a vacation spot that truly offers something for every Escondido real estate family member. Look for hotels, resorts and summer getaway locations that offer a wide variety of activities for you to enjoy.
  • Don't schedule your vacation for too long. Your family might be busy in balancing school, jobs, sports, homework, and other activities everytime. Remember that a vacation is time to relax and unwind during this relative down time.
  • If you are going to travel with another Escondido real estate family, you should clear things out about everyone's expectations about the vacation. Discuss witho them the time you will be spending together as well as all the costs included in the trip.
  • Take out boredom during travel time. Bring some stuff that everyone would enjoy. Make sure those things fit the age of each family member. Bring electronic games, self-contained craft kits, books on tape and the like.
  • Be informative. Make sure that you are prepared about knowing all the information about the place you are going to be as your vacation spot. You can search the places' information at the web as well as for you to identify what are the available activities that the vacation spot is going to offer to you.
  • Disconnect from all your gadgets that keeps you away from connecting and socializing with your family members. You can drop your phones for a moment, stop texting, cut the phone calls and etc. By this, you can reconnect with your family, friends and other friends from Escondido real estate.
  • Always find a way to sneak in an educational experience lesson. Learning is a continuous process for your kids and yourself as well. Try to visit hands-on, walk in the footsteps of the history of the location, go to kid-friendly museums and etc. learning can be equaled to having fun.

Heed these tips so you can have a better and more memorable vacation. Having fun doesn't have to mean spending a lot of money or gaining unnecessary stress.
